    I think you look to Blockpress as experienced user of classic themes, like GeneratePress. FSE themes have totally another logic, they have nothing hard coded in php templates. All templates are blocks which you can edit or remove. I recommend to check in google “what is FSE themes wordpress”

    9. Largest Contentful Paint – this is related on 90% on content which you have in first screen. Why do you have bad LCP with Blockpress? Because your page with GeneratePress, Neve has no menu, which takes some time to load. Try to remove menu also in Blockpress and check. To be true, I don’t understand why you have such time, something wrong with setup. See our demo, it has no caching at all and near 300ms for LCP. When I disable menu and search as you did on GP, it’s near 200ms for LCP

    Thanks for your comprehensive reply. Related to “Load Google Fonts Locally” or “Self-Hosted Google Fonts”, I’m Not referring to the ability of Upload Custom Fonts. What I’m referring to is that when we choose any Google Font from the Blockpress settings “Global Typography”, it would be great if you add in Blockpress an option to automatically downloads and stores the selected Google Fonts locally on our own website server.

    This way, the?Google Fonts being loaded locally, is much better for performance than loading the fonts from the Google CDN. This is already done in some popular themes like Astra(free version), Kadence theme(free version), Blocksy(PRO version), etc…

    You can check how this works by installing for example the “Kadence theme”, and after the installation go to the Theme Customizer and select any Google Font that you want in Customizer -> Color & Fonts -> Typography, after that, also in the Theme Customizer you can activate?the option to “Load Google Fonts Locally” in Customizer -> General -> Performance. Once you Enable “Load Google Fonts Locally” there will appear the option “Preload Local Fonts”, please, Enable this also.

    Now you can go to Google “PageSpeed Insights” and run some Tests with the “Load Google Fonts Locally” option and also?the “Preload Local Fonts”?option both “Enabled” and another Test with these options “Disabled”. You will see a Big difference in Performance.
